PROBLEM: The typical way of organizing books by author
doesn’t work for me. I can’t always remember who wrote the book. Plus, when I’m going to re-shelf the book, the author’s name isn’t always in the same place on the spine. It’s irritating to figure out where the book goes.

SOLUTION: Try and figure out how you remember books. If it isn’t by author might it be by size, color, or year that you acquired them? When you figure out how you remember your books you can organize them accordingly.

HINT: Remember , organization is all
about what works for you.
